Abstract Varicocele is a common finding in adolescents and men. Its association with male infertility has been well documented: varicoceles are reported to be present in 20 % to 40 % of infertile men (Belgrano et al, 1999). In the general population the incidence is between 15 and 18 % on physical examination (Jarow et al, 1996), 18 and 35 % on scrotal sonography and color flow Doppler imaging, respectively (Meacham et al, 1994). |
